Battery Replacement

It may be that your Mitsubishi key fob is not connecting to your car. A new battery could be needed. It's an simple fix, and you can usually do it at home. All you need is a package of 2032 batteries and a flathead screwdriver. Find the small notch or slot in the key fob where it is attached to your key ring, and then use the flat side of the screwdriver to gently pop open the two halves. Replace the old battery and ensure that it is polarized correctly. Once everything is in place then snap the halves together and test the fob to make sure it is functioning.

Transponder Chip Replacement

Transponder chips will likely be found in every mitsubishi car key replacement cost uk model produced in the past 20 years. Transponder chips are one of the most important security features in modern vehicles since they make it impossible for anyone to start your car with a duplicate key.

Transponder chips consist of a micro-circuit, which transmits an indication when the ignition is switched on. The car reads the signal to determine if it's the correct key. If the car can't find an appropriate match it won't start and will remain off. This makes it extremely difficult to hot wire an automobile with a transponder chip, but it doesn't stop thieves from trying to steal cars using them.

Traditional Car Key

If your Mitsubishi has a traditional key that does not have a fancy chip, you can request an alternative from a locksmith without having to take the old key with you. They look just like other standard car key and can be replaced for a low cost. You can also request a replacement from a dealer, but they will require proof that proves you are the owner of the vehicle, like your registration or title.
